随着微信小程序的普及,越来越多的开发者开始关注小程序的开发技巧。在这个过程中,雨山小程序无疑成为了很多开发者的首选工具。本文将深度解析雨山小程序的高级开发技巧,探讨如何在雨山小程序中应用各种开发技巧,从而提高小程序的开发效率和用户体验。
1. 雨山小程序的基本架构
雨山小程序的基本架构由三部分组成:html5,css和JavaScript。其中,html5用于页面的结构和布局;css用于页面的样式和布局;JavaScript用于页面的交互和逻辑处理。
2. 雨山小程序的模块化开发
雨山小程序支持模块化开发,可以将不同的功能模块按照一定的规则封装成不同的文件,提高程序的可读性和可维护性。在模块化开发中,我们可以使用require和exports来实现代码的组织和模块之间的依赖性管理。
3. 雨山小程序的数据绑定
数据绑定是雨山小程序的一个重要特性,它可以将页面和数据进行绑定,实现数据的自动更新。在实现数据绑定时,我们可以通过使用{{}}将数据绑定到页面中指定的标签上,实现数据和页面的实时同步。
4. 雨山小程序的组件化开发
雨山小程序的组件化开发是实现代码重用和提高开发效率的重要手段。在组件化开发中,我们可以将相同的功能和样式封装成组件,供多个页面和程序重用。在定义组件时,我们需要定义组件的属性和事件,以便组件可以接收页面的数据和响应页面的事件。
5. 雨山小程序的优化技巧
雨山小程序的优化技巧是提高小程序性能和用户体验的重要手段。在优化技巧中,我们可以采用异步加载、缓存数据、小程序分包等技巧,提高小程序的响应速度和用户体验。
本文深度解析了雨山小程序的高级开发技巧,从基本架构到组件化开发,再到数据绑定和优化技巧,全面介绍了如何在雨山小程序中应用各种开发技巧,以提高小程序的开发效率和用户体验。同时,我们也需要注意代码的可读性和可维护性,以便更好地管理和维护小程序。作为一个雨山小程序的开发者,不断地学习和探索新的技术和工具,才能更好地满足用户的需求,提高小程序的品质和用户口碑。
随着小程序的普及,越来越多的开发者加入到小程序开发的行列中。而针对雨山小程序高级开发技巧的深度解析,将为开发者们提供一种全新的视角和思考方式,帮助他们更加深入地理解小程序的背后机制,以及如何应用这些技巧来提升小程序的功能和性能。
1. 优化用户体验
针对小程序的用户体验进行优化是开发者们不得不关注的重要问题。其中,关注小程序的加载速度和稳定性,是保证用户体验的核心因素之一。
2. 探索性能优化
性能优化是小程序开发中另一个重要的方面,而在进行性能优化时,有许多可以使用的技巧可以帮助提高小程序的运行效率和稳定性。
3. 加强安全防范
现在,随着小程序的普及,越来越多的开发者用小程序来处理敏感信息,这就需要注重安全方面的考虑,确保用户的隐私和数据安全。
4. 应用高级功能
小程序的高级功能是它的一大优势,如canvas、webview、离线缓存等技术。应用这些高级功能可以增强小程序的交互和视觉效果,为用户带来更加舒适和便捷的体验。
5. 推广与分析
推广和分析是对小程序成功运营的至关重要的一环,只有通过不断分析和调整,才能为小程序的发展带来新的动力,从而获得更大的用户群体。
雨山小程序的高级开发技巧需要我们不断深入的了解和研究,我们可以从不同的角度入手,从优化用户体验、性能优化、安全防范、应用高级功能等多方面去探索其奥秘,同时需要加强推广和分析,才能为小程序的成功发展提供新的动力和支持。